Trexquant Investment LP purchased a new position in shares of NACCO Industries, Inc. (NYSE:NC - Free Report) in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or purchased 9,443 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$282,000. Trexquant Investment LP owned 0.13% of NACCO Industries at the end of the most recent reporting period.

NACCO Industries Announces Dividend
The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, March 17th. Stockholders of record on Monday, March 3rd were given a $0.2275 dividend. This represents a $0.91 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.47%. The ex-dividend date was Monday, March 3rd. NACCO Industries's dividend payout ratio is currently 19.87%.

NACCO Industries,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the natural resources business. The company operates through three segments: Coal Mining, North American Mining, and Minerals Management. The Coal Mining segment operates surface coal mines under long-term contracts with power generation companies.
